Understanding the Pillar Drill: A Versatile Tool for Precision Drilling
The pillar drill, often understood as a column drill or a pedestal drill, is a powerhouse tool that masters different commercial and DIY applications. Distinguished for its precision and versatility, the pillar drill can be discovered in workshops, producing plants, and home garages alike. This post intends to look into the functionalities, advantages, and upkeep of the pillar drill while using insights through tables and FAQs.
What is a Pillar Drill?
A pillar drill is a kind of drilling device that features a vertical column supporting the drill head, which is normally run through mechanical levers or an electric motor. Its style supplies stability and accuracy, making it perfect for different tasks such as drilling holes in wood, metal, plastic, and other products.
Secret Components of a Pillar Drill
To much better understand how a pillar drill works, it’s necessary to know its essential parts:

The choice of drill bit significantly affects the efficiency and result of a drilling job. The following table outlines the common types of drill bits used with pillar drills:

A1: A pillar drill is usually taller, created to be mounted on a stand or pedestal, allowing for deeper drilling. A bench drill is smaller sized and designed to rest on a workbench, ideal for lighter tasks.
Q2: Can I utilize a pillar drill for milling operations?
A2: While a pillar drill is primarily developed for drilling, it can perform light milling tasks with the right tools and setup. However, it is not a replacement for a devoted milling machine.
Q3: What types of products can be drilled with a pillar drill?
A3: Pillar drills can be used on different products, consisting of wood, metals, plastics, and composites.
